This content, featuring insights from a former SEAL officer, emphasizes that effective training standards are directly tied to functional capabilities and the ability to dominate an environment. It highlights the importance of understanding the 'why' behind drills, using Night Vision Goggles (NVGs) as an example for achieving real-world objectives like rapid target engagement at distance and pistol transitions, rather than simply meeting arbitrary metrics.
